Está en la página 1de 28

´ ´

LENGUAJE MATEMATICO, CONJUNTOS Y NUMEROS

CAPÍTULO 3: RELACIONES Y APLICACIONES

Pedro Alegrı́a

Centro Asociado de Portugalete (Bizkaia)

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 1 / 20


Índice

1 APLICACIONES ENTRE CONJUNTOS

2 OPERACIONES CON APLICACIONES

3 TIPOS DE APLICACIONES

4 FACTORIZACIÓN CANÓNICA

5 EQUIPOTENCIA DE CONJUNTOS

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 2 / 20


APLICACIONES ENTRE CONJUNTOS

Aplicaciones entre conjuntos

Una relación f entre los conjuntos A y B, es decir


f ⊂ A × B, se denomina aplicación de A en B si y sólo si
cualquier elemento del conjunto inicial A está relacionado
con un único elemento del conjunto final B.
(*) ∀a ∈ A, ∃b ∈ B : (a, b) ∈ f ;
(*) (a, b) ∈ f, (a, b0 ) ∈ f =⇒ b = b0 .

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 3 / 20


APLICACIONES ENTRE CONJUNTOS

Aplicaciones entre conjuntos

Una relación f entre los conjuntos A y B, es decir


f ⊂ A × B, se denomina aplicación de A en B si y sólo si
cualquier elemento del conjunto inicial A está relacionado
con un único elemento del conjunto final B.
(*) ∀a ∈ A, ∃b ∈ B : (a, b) ∈ f ;
(*) (a, b) ∈ f, (a, b0 ) ∈ f =⇒ b = b0 .
Notación. f ⊂ A × B se representa por f : A → B;
(x, y) ∈ f se representa por y = f (x).

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 3 / 20


APLICACIONES ENTRE CONJUNTOS

Aplicaciones entre conjuntos

Una relación f entre los conjuntos A y B, es decir


f ⊂ A × B, se denomina aplicación de A en B si y sólo si
cualquier elemento del conjunto inicial A está relacionado
con un único elemento del conjunto final B.
(*) ∀a ∈ A, ∃b ∈ B : (a, b) ∈ f ;
(*) (a, b) ∈ f, (a, b0 ) ∈ f =⇒ b = b0 .
Notación. f ⊂ A × B se representa por f : A → B;
(x, y) ∈ f se representa por y = f (x).
Conjunto imagen de X ⊂ A:
f (X) = {y ∈ B : ∃x ∈ X, y = f (x)}.
Conjunto imagen inversa de Y ⊂ B:
f −1 (Y ) = {x ∈ A : f (x) ∈ Y }.
Grafo de la aplicación:
G(f ) = {(x, y) ∈ A × B : y = f (x)}.
P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 3 / 20
APLICACIONES ENTRE CONJUNTOS

Ejemplos.

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 4 / 20


APLICACIONES ENTRE CONJUNTOS

Ejemplos.

La relación y = log x no es aplicación cuando A = R


pero sı́ lo es cuando A = (0, ∞).
La relación x2 + y 2√= 1 no es aplicación
√ pero sı́ lo son
las relaciones y = 1 − x , y = − 1 − x2 .
2

Si E es una relación de equivalencia en A, la aplicación


p : A → A/E dada por p(x) = [x] se llama proyección
canónica.

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 4 / 20


OPERACIONES CON APLICACIONES

Composición de aplicaciones

Dadas las aplicaciones f : A −→ B y g : B −→ C, se define


la composición de f y g, como la aplicación g ◦ f : A → C
dada por
∀x ∈ A, (g ◦ f )(x) = g(f (x)).

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 5 / 20


OPERACIONES CON APLICACIONES

Composición de aplicaciones

Dadas las aplicaciones f : A −→ B y g : B −→ C, se define


la composición de f y g, como la aplicación g ◦ f : A → C
dada por
∀x ∈ A, (g ◦ f )(x) = g(f (x)).

g
A f B C f g
a R −→ R −→ R
1 5
2 b 7 x 7−→ x2 7−→ cos(x2 )
c
3 d 9
(g ◦ f )(1) = g(f (1)) = g(c) = 7 , (g ◦ f )(x) = cos(x2 )
(g ◦ f )(2) = g(f (2)) = g(b) = 5,
(g ◦ f )(3) = g(f (3)) = g(a) = 5 .

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 5 / 20


TIPOS DE APLICACIONES

Aplicación sobreyectiva

f : A −→ B es sobreyectiva si f (A) = B, o bien

∀y ∈ B, ∃x ∈ A tal que f (x) = y.

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 6 / 20


TIPOS DE APLICACIONES

Aplicación sobreyectiva

f : A −→ B es sobreyectiva si f (A) = B, o bien

∀y ∈ B, ∃x ∈ A tal que f (x) = y.

A f B

1
a
2
b
3
c
4

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 6 / 20


TIPOS DE APLICACIONES

Aplicación sobreyectiva

Propiedad. Si f : A → B y g : B → C son sobreyectivas,


entonces g ◦ f : A → C es sobreyectiva.
Demostración. Dado z ∈ C, existe y ∈ B tal que g(y) = z.
Además, existe x ∈ A tal que f (x) = y. Entonces
(g ◦ f )(x) = g(f (x)) = g(y) = z.

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 7 / 20


TIPOS DE APLICACIONES

Aplicación sobreyectiva

Propiedad. Si f : A → B y g : B → C son sobreyectivas,


entonces g ◦ f : A → C es sobreyectiva.
Demostración. Dado z ∈ C, existe y ∈ B tal que g(y) = z.
Además, existe x ∈ A tal que f (x) = y. Entonces
(g ◦ f )(x) = g(f (x)) = g(y) = z.

Propiedad. Una aplicación f : A → B es sobreyectiva si y


sólo si existe h : B → A tal que f ◦ h : IB .
Demostración. Si f es sobreyectiva, dado b ∈ B, existe
a ∈ A tal que f (a) = b. Definimos h(a) = b. Entonces
(f ◦ h)(b) = f (h(b)) = f (a) = b.
Recı́procamente, si f ◦ h = IB , dado cualquier b ∈ B,
llamamos a = h(b). Entonces
f (a) = f (h(b)) = (f ◦ h)(b) = b, de modo que f es
sobreyectiva.
P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 7 / 20
TIPOS DE APLICACIONES

Aplicación inyectiva

f : A −→ B es inyectiva si
∀x, x0 ∈ A, x 6= x0 =⇒ f (x) 6= f (x0 ), o bien
∀x, x0 ∈ A, f (x) = f (x0 ) =⇒ x = x0 .

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 8 / 20


TIPOS DE APLICACIONES

Aplicación inyectiva

f : A −→ B es inyectiva si
∀x, x0 ∈ A, x 6= x0 =⇒ f (x) 6= f (x0 ), o bien
∀x, x0 ∈ A, f (x) = f (x0 ) =⇒ x = x0 .

A f B

1 a
b
2 c

f (x) = x2 no es inyectiva en (−1, 1).


f (x) = x3 sı́ es inyectiva en (−1, 1).
Propiedad. Si f y g son inyectivas, entonces g ◦ f es
inyectiva.
P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 8 / 20
TIPOS DE APLICACIONES

Aplicación biyectiva

f : A −→ B es biyectiva si es sobreyectiva e inyectiva:

∀y ∈ B, existe un único elemento x ∈ A tal que f (x) = y.

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 9 / 20


TIPOS DE APLICACIONES

Aplicación biyectiva

f : A −→ B es biyectiva si es sobreyectiva e inyectiva:

∀y ∈ B, existe un único elemento x ∈ A tal que f (x) = y.

Ejemplos.

A f B

1 a
2 b
3 c

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 9 / 20


TIPOS DE APLICACIONES

Aplicaciones inversas
1) f : A −→ B es sobreyectiva si y sólo si existe
h : B −→ A (inyectiva) tal que f ◦ h = IB .
2) f : A −→ B es inyectiva si y sólo si existe g : B −→ A
(sobreyectiva) tal que g ◦ f = IA .
3) f : A −→ B es biyectiva si y sólo si existe g : B −→ A
biyectiva tal que f ◦ g = IB y g ◦ f = IA .
En este caso escribimos g = f −1 .

h f f g
B A B A B A

a 1 a a
1 1
2 b
b 3 b 2 c 2

f ◦ h = IB g ◦ f = IA

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 10 / 20


TIPOS DE APLICACIONES

Propiedades de la composición

Si f : A −→ B y g : B −→ C son biyectivas, entonces


g ◦ f : A −→ C es biyectiva. Además, (g ◦ f )−1 = f −1 ◦ g −1 .
Ejemplos.
Si f (x) = sen x y g(x) = x2 , entonces
(g ◦ f )(x) = sen2 (x), siempre que g : [−1, 1] → [0, 1].
Si f (x) = sen x y g(x) = ex , entonces
(g ◦ f )(x) = esen x , siempre que
f : [−π/2, π/2] → [−1, 1].
Sean f : [0, π] → [−1, 1] y g : [−1, 1] → [−2, 2] dadas
por f (x) = cos x, g(x) = 2x. Entonces

f −1 (x) = arc cos x, g −1 (x) = x/2;


(g ◦ f )(x) = 2 cos x, (g ◦ f )−1 (x) = arc cos (x/2) .

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 11 / 20


FACTORIZACIÓN CANÓNICA

Factorización canónica de una aplicación


1 A toda aplicación f : A −→ B se le puede asociar la
relación de equivalencia en A dada por
xEf y si y sólo si f (x) = f (y).

f
A B
a
1
b
2
c
3
d
4 e

Ef = {(1, 1), (1, 2), (2, 1), (2, 2), (3, 3), (4, 4)}
A/Ef = {{1, 2}, {3}, {4}} = {[1], [3], [4]}
P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 12 / 20
FACTORIZACIÓN CANÓNICA

Factorización canónica de una aplicación

2 Toda relación de equivalencia E en A define la


aplicación sobreyectiva, llamada proyección canónica,
p : A → A/E dada por p(x) = [x].

E = {(1, 1), (1, 2), (2, 1), (2, 2), (3, 3), (4, 4)}
A/E = {{1, 2}, {3}, {4}} = {[1], [3], [4]}

p
A A/E
1 [1]
2
[3]
3
[4]
4

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 13 / 20


FACTORIZACIÓN CANÓNICA

Factorización canónica de una aplicación

3 A toda aplicación f : A → B se le puede asociar la


biyección canónica b : A/Ef → f (A).

Ef = {(1, 1), (1, 2), (2, 1), (2, 2), (3, 3), (4, 4)}
A/Ef = {{1, 2}, {3}, {4}} = {[1], [3], [4]}

f A/Ef
b
f (A) ⊂ B
A B
1 a a
b [1] b
2 c c
[3]
3
d [4] d
4 e e

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 14 / 20


FACTORIZACIÓN CANÓNICA

Factorización canónica de una aplicación

Cualquier aplicación f : A −→ B, puede descomponerse en


la siguiente forma:
f f
A B A3x f (x) ∈ B

p i p i

b b
A/Ef f (A) A/Ef 3 [x] f (x) ∈ f (A)

p es sobreyectiva, b es biyectiva, i es inyectiva.

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 15 / 20


FACTORIZACIÓN CANÓNICA

Factorización canónica de una aplicación

Ejemplos
Factorización canónica de las funciones f (x) = cos x y
g(x) = x2 .

f g
x cos x x x2

p i p i

b b x2
[x] = {x + 2kπ} cos x [x] = {x, −x}

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 16 / 20


EQUIPOTENCIA DE CONJUNTOS

Equipotencia de conjuntos

Dos conjuntos A y B son equipotentes si y sólo si existe una


biyección entre ellos.
Ejemplos
El conjunto N∗ y el subconjunto de los números pares
son equipotentes.

N ≡ Z ≡ Q; card (N) = ℵ0 .

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 17 / 20


EQUIPOTENCIA DE CONJUNTOS

Equipotencia de conjuntos

Dos intervalos cualesquiera (a, b) y (c, d) de la recta son


equipotentes.

tg x : (−π/2, π/2) −→ (−∞, ∞)

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 18 / 20


EJERCICIOS

Ejercicio 1
(feb. 17) Dadas las aplicaciones f, g : N → N definidas por
f (n) = 2n, g(n) = E(n/2), determinar si son inyectivas o
sobreyectivas y calcular las composiciones f ◦ g y g ◦ f .
La aplicación f es inyectiva porque, si f (n) = f (m),
entonces 2n = 2m, de donde n = m. Sin embargo no
es sobreyectiva porque cualquier número impar no tiene
preimagen.
La aplicación g no es inyectiva porque g(n) = k para
cualquier n tal que 2k ≤ n < 2k + 2. Tampoco es
sobreyectiva porque ningún número que no es natural
está en la imagen de g.
Por definición, (f ◦ g)(n) = f (E(n/2)) = 2E(n/2). La
imagen de esta función es 2k para cualquier número
natural n tal que 2k ≤ n < 2k + 2.
Por otra parte, (g ◦ f )(n) = g(2n) = E(n).

P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 19 / 20


EJERCICIOS

Ejercicio 2
(sep. 15) Sea f : [0, 1] → [0, 1] una aplicación creciente y
A = {x ∈ [0, 1] : f (x) ≤ x}. Probar que A 6= ∅, que
f (A) ⊂ A y que, si a = ı́nf A, entonces f (a) = a.
Es evidente que A 6= ∅ porque 1 ∈ A (siempre
f (1) ≤ 1). Hay que observar que f no es
necesariamente biyectiva, es decir que no es
necesariamente cierto que f (1) = 1.
Si y ∈ f (A), entonces existe x ∈ A tal que f (x) = y.
Pero f (x) ≤ x, de donde y ≤ x. Por ser f creciente,
f (y) ≤ f (x) = y, es decir y ∈ A.
Por ser a = ı́nf A, para cualquier ε > 0, a + ε ∈ A, de
donde f (a) ≤ f (a + ε) ≤ a + ε =⇒ f (a) ≤ a con lo
que f (a) es cota inferior de A.
Si fuera f (a) < a, entonces f (a) 6∈ A, de donde
f (f (a)) > f (a), con lo que f (a) < f (f (a)) ≤ f (a), lo
que es imposible.
P. Alegrı́a (UNED) Lenguaje matemático, conjuntos y números 20 / 20

También podría gustarte